Resumo

Fernando Montesinos wrote his work entitled Ophir de España in the mid-seventeenth century. The essential motive of it was to link the biblical Ophir with America. In order to do this, he resorted to a whole series of works and authors on which to base his theory. Among them the Greco-Roman authors, pagans, Christians and including false chronicones. In the first place, it emphasizes above all the Christian authors of the first centuries, including Flavio Dextro and his attributed work. Among the classics does not emphasize any author, not even Pliny, widely used for American descriptions of the time.
